Pros of Competitive Sports for Team Building
Enhanced Communication
One of the primary benefits of competitive sports in team building is the enhancement of communication skills. During games, team members must constantly communicate to strategize and make quick decisions. This improved communication translates into better coordination and understanding in the workplace.
Building Trust and Cooperation

Cons of Competitive Sports for Team Building
Potential for Conflict
While competition can be healthy, it also has the potential to lead to conflicts. Intense competitive environments may cause disagreements or tension among team members. Body Back addresses this by promoting a culture of respect and sportsmanship, ensuring conflicts are resolved constructively.
Risk of Exclusion
Not everyone may have the same level of interest or ability in sports. This can lead to some team members feeling excluded or less valued. Body Back designs inclusive activities that cater to all skill levels, ensuring everyone feels involved and appreciated.

Practical Tips for Successful Team Building Through Sports
- Set Clear Objectives: Define what you aim to achieve through the team building activities.
- Foster a Positive Environment: Encourage respect, sportsmanship, and inclusivity.
- Balance Competition and Fun: Ensure activities are competitive yet enjoyable.
- Promote Collaboration: Design activities that require teamwork and cooperation.
- Provide Continuous Support: Offer guidance and support to all team members throughout the activities.
